The hosts of "The Colonial Gang" during their inaugural broadcast.

The Colonial Gang is new wireless current affairs / talkshow broadcast within the Fleet.

The first broadcast by the show is held during the interim Quorum of Twelve selection aboard Cloud Nine.

The program is hosted by three of the self-styled "only legitimate journalists left in the universe":

Both Hamilton and Palacios are supporters of President Roslin, while McManus is deliberately outspoken against her abilities, possibly for the sake of heated debate in order to generate an audience.

Notes

The name is a pun on the political discussion television show The Capital Gang, which aired on CNN.
